Description
Enzymes play a crucial role in the biological processes that sustain life, acting as catalysts that speed up chemical reactions in living organisms. This concise introduction delves into the fascinating world of enzymes, exploring their complex structures, functions, and the intricate ways they interact with other molecules. Through accessible explanations and vivid examples, the author sheds light on how these molecular machines are fundamental to everything from digestion to DNA replication.
As readers turn the pages, they gain insights into the latest scientific discoveries and the implications of enzyme research in fields like medicine and biotechnology. The text is a gateway to understanding why enzymes are not only integral to life on Earth but also key players in advancing technological innovations.
